Single large turbo is great for Drag strip but not so responsive for street driving. Two smaller turbos are more effective for street RPM range. Single tubo almost feels like a Centeri S/C with long turbo lag.
I drove one on a Camaro once and the boost didn't come in till 5000 RPM. By then it was too late to use the boost.

Sounds more like it wasn't the right turbo for the motor it was paired with. A lot of folks just throw a turbo on and go, but motor details need to be taken into account when searching for the right turbo to perform properly, that goes for single and twins and the same can be said for blowers as well. :thumbsup:

Not so anymore. Compressor wheels and hybrids have come a long way. A single 76 billet wheel T4 would be nice for a 5.0L. I almost went large single (88 billet T6) on my 6.7L but I could pass up the deal I got on my twins for the Z06.
